Tunis: Tunisian world and Paralympic champion Walid Ktila offered Tunisia its 3rd gold medal at the Kobe Para-athletics World Championships, held in Japan, after winning on Tuesday the Men's 100m T34 Round 1 Heat 1/2.It is the 3rd gold medal after those won by Yassine Guennichi in the shot put (F36) and Raoua Tlili in the same event (F41).It was also Ktila's second personal medal after the silver in the 400m.Tunisia now counts 9 medals (3 gold, 3 silver and 3 bronze).Source: Agence Tunis Afrique Presse
